The AMX MU - 3300 MUSE Automation Controller by HARMAN Professional is a top - notch, secure, and highly reliable device. It's designed to handle the most challenging automation needs. Running on the AMX MUSE automation platform, it can execute an almost limitless number of scripts written in JavaScript, Python, or Groovy, offering excellent performance for complex automation tasks. It also supports Low - Code development with Node - RED, providing flexible and easy - to - use programming options.
With a modern embedded processor that's 10 times faster than the one in AMX NX Controllers, the MU - 3300 ensures quick and efficient processing, enabling real - time automation with little delay. Its robust, industrial - grade eMMC storage makes it suitable for 24/7 high - access installations where reliability is key. Built on HARMAN’s secure Linux platform, it meets the security needs of even the most sensitive environments.
The MU - 3300 integrates smoothly with both new and old HARMAN Professional products. It supports HControl, HiQnet, and ICSP natively, making it a perfect fit for any automation system. Whether you're automating a new space or upgrading old equipment, it offers the scalability and flexibility for a complete automation solution.
The compact 1RU form factor allows for easy integration into standard racks. Its extensive I/O options, including 8 serial ports, 8 relays, 8 IR ports, and 8 I/O ports, provide unmatched connectivity for various control and automation tasks. The ICSLan network port creates an isolated network for controlled devices, enhancing security and ensuring smooth communication.

### Technical Specifications
- **Ports**: Front: (1) USB - C Program Port, (1) USB - A Host Port; Rear: (1) 12V DC input, (1) LAN Port, (1) ICSLan Port, (2) RS - 232/422/485, (6) RS - 232, (8) I/O, (8) IR, (8) Relays, (2) USB - A Host Ports
- **Power Requirements**: DC input voltage (typical): 12V DC; DC current draw: 3A Max; DC range, voltage: 9 - 18 VDC
- **Environmental**: Operating Temperature: 32°F (0°C) to 122°F (50°C); Storage Temperature: 14°F (-10°C) to 140°F (60°C); Operating Humidity: 5% to 85% RH; Heat Dissipation (On): 10.2 BTU/hr
- **Regulatory Compliance**: ICES 003, CE EN 55032, AUS/NZ CISPR 32, CE EN 55035, CE EN 62368 - 1, IEC 62368 - 1, UL 62368 - 1, VCCI CISPR 32, RoHS / WEEE Compliant
- **Dimensions**: 1.766' x 17' x 9.12' (44.85mm x 431.8mm x 231.64mm); Weight: 6 lb (2.7kg)
- **SKU Number**: AMX - CCC033; JITC Status: In Testing

Using the AMX MU - 3300 MUSE Automation Controller is quite straightforward. First, make sure you connect it to a power source within the 9 - 18 VDC range. The typical input voltage is 12V DC, and the maximum current draw is 3A. You can use the various ports on the front and rear for different connections. For programming, use the USB - C Program Port on the front.
When it comes to running scripts, you can write them in JavaScript, Python, or Groovy and run them on the AMX MUSE automation platform. If you prefer Low - Code development, you can use Node - RED.
Here are some important notes. Keep the operating temperature between 32°F (0°C) and 122°F (50°C) and the operating humidity between 5% and 85% RH. Also, since it's built for high - access 24/7 use, ensure proper ventilation to prevent overheating.
For maintenance, regularly check the connections to make sure they are secure. The industrial - grade eMMC storage is quite reliable, but it's a good idea to back up your important scripts and data periodically. And if you're integrating it with other HARMAN devices, ensure that the protocols (HControl, HiQnet, ICSP) are set up correctly.
